What Is Dutch Weave Mesh?
Unlike standard plain weave mesh (uniform wire diameters/square openings), Dutch weave uses thicker warp wires and finer, tightly packed weft wires—creating a dense, tortuous flow path with no straight-through holes. This specialized structure enables micron-level filtration accuracy (5–500 μm) while maintaining high tensile strength and pressure resistance. Three professional weave styles meet diverse needs:
Plain Dutch Weave: Balanced strength and precision for general fine filtration.
Twill Dutch Weave: Diagonal pattern for tighter mesh, enhanced flow stability, and higher dirt-holding capacity.
Reverse Dutch Weave: Finer warp/thicker weft for extreme pressure resistance and easy backwashing (ideal for high-viscosity media).
Premium Materials for Harsh Environments
We use only certified high-performance alloys to ensure corrosion resistance, temperature stability, and long-term reliability—solving material failure issues in aggressive conditions:
Standard Grades: SUS304/SUS316 (excellent corrosion resistance, cost-effective for general industrial use).
Low-Carbon Grades: 316L/310S (superior resistance to acid/alkali, ideal for chemical, food, and marine environments).
High-Performance Alloys: 904L/2205/2507 (duplex/super austenitic alloys for extreme corrosion, high-temperature, and high-pressure applications).
Custom Materials: Pure nickel, low-carbon steel, and specialty alloys available for unique project requirements.
